Background & Objective

Since the introduction of the first National Solid Waste Management Policy, strengthening waste and resource management has become a key priority for the Maldives. The government’s commitment to a clean environment is continuous, among others through the implementation of the Strategic Action Plan (SAP) and the Single Use Plastics Phase Out Plan. A new National Waste Management Policy is being developed. The new Policy encompasses the principles of waste hierarchy and circular economy. It aims to engage the local communities and the private sector to shift towards a Sustainable Development model that will view Waste as Resource. The priority will be given to avoidance of waste generation and reuse as the optimum option, followed by recycling, energy recovery, and as a last and less desired option by landfilling.

The aim of the public consultation will be to present pragmatic and ambitious goals and measures of the Policy. The opinion and feed-back from the public will be highly acknowledged.
